Detached six-bay single-storey gable-fronted national school, dated 1927. Single-storey flat-roofed entrance porches to east and west, flat-roofed projection to rear. Hipped slate roofs, pitched to gable front, clay ridge and hip tiles, unpainted smooth rendered corbelled chimneystack with splayed cap, painted timber bargeboards, cast-iron gutters on brackets on eaves corbel course, cast-iron downpipes. Unpainted pebbledash walling, painted smooth rendered quoins, band at window head height, projecting plinth, date plaque under painted smooth rendered label moulding reads "Dromiskin National School 1927". Square-headed window openings, splayed heads, painted smooth rendered surrounds, painted stone sills, painted timber six-over-nine sliding sash windows grouped in threes. Square-headed door openings, splayed heads, shouldered painted smooth rendered surrounds, painted timber diagonally- sheeted doors. Opening onto bitmac area at front, lean-to bicycle shed to rear, situated within curtilage of Saint Peter's Church.
